With the biggest country music fan pick in the 2025 NFL Draft, the Denver Broncos selected Jahdae Barron. The defensive back out of Texas had his name called by the “Mile High” team during the first round of last month’s NFL Draft, and he’s already being considered one of the steals of the first round. Barron was widely expected to go within the top 10 or 12 picks, and when he dropped all the way to No. 20, the Broncos couldn’t pass him up. Considering Barron is a dark horse candidate for the NFL Defensive Rookie of the Year award, I’d say it was a pick-well-used by the Denver Broncos. Barron played corner, slot corner, and safety while he was with the Longhorns, so the Broncos are getting a talented and versatile player in the 23-year-old. Though he is deservingly getting a lot of attention for his skills on the football field, there’s a lot about Barron’s off-the-field personality that makes him interesting too. Not only has he said that his favorite person in the world is Matthew McConaughey (there’s a Texas connection there, so that makes sense), he’s also proclaimed his love for the genre of country music. Specifically, he loves the King of Country himself – George Strait. Don’t believe me? Well may I point you to the night that Barron accepted the Jim Thorpe Award back in February. This year’s Jim Thorpe Award ceremony, which honors the best defensive back in college football every single year, had quite the acceptance speech. I actually don’t know if it was a speech… it was more of a celebratory song, performed by Jahdae Barron himself. In reality, it looks like Jahdae Barron just appreciates all things country. He wore a cowboy hat during his draft party, and also had one ready to go in his official first pictures with the Denver Broncos. If he sounds like he’s a country fan (singing George Strait), and he looks like he’s a country fan (Cowboy hat), he’s gotta be a country fan.
